Welcome to TEFAP Alliance The TEFAP Alliance is an informal coalition of local, state, and national organizations involved with and supporting The Emergency Food Assistance Program or TEFAP. TEFAP is a federal program that helps supplement the diets of low-income Americans, including elderly people, by providing them with commodity foods and nutrition assistance at no cost. Government-donated TEFAP foods are often distributed with emergency food donations from other sources. The purpose of the TEFAP Alliance is to promote knowledge and understanding of TEFAP and other services addressing the food, nutrition, and hunger needs of low-income Americans. This web site provides information on TEFAP and allied programs that deliver food and nutrition assistance. This web site and the TEFAP Alliance are supported by California Emergency Foodlink, a non-profit organization based in Sacramento, California. Foodlink’s mission is providing jobs, preventing hunger, and training for the future. Through TEFAP, its award-winning truck driving training program, and its statewide agricultural fresh produce rescue program – Donate Don’t Dump – Foodlink distributes more than 70 million pounds of food annually at no charge to recipient agencies.
